Carl Zeiss Expands Original Equipment Manufacturers Initiative


Thornwood, N.Y. - Carl Zeiss, a leading provider of microscopy solutions for a variety of research, clinical and industrial applications, recently announced a new Original Equipment Manufacturers (OEM) partner initiative. OEM companies develop and market specialized solutions and imaging systems based on a traditional microscope or highly specialized "black box" optical systems.

Carl Zeiss has been actively engaged with OEM companies for many years, and has proven to be a reliable partner. The new OEM initiative provides additional resources with increased support for partner companies by helping to address technical questions and by making it easier to conduct business with Carl Zeiss.

OEM companies are responding to customers' continued demand for application-specific problem solving solutions based on a very detailed understanding of the underlying application requirements. While Carl Zeiss offers a wide spectrum of such application driven customer solutions for a large segment of the market, OEM companies often develop highly customized solutions for specific niche applications.

In developing these solutions, OEM companies are looking to minimize risks, development time and cost and to bring to market powerful solutions exceeding the target customers' needs and requirements. Carl Zeiss helps OEM companies in optimizing the development process in the following ways:
  • Dedicated and highly experienced US-based OEM Partner Manager.
  • Outstanding optical performance and mechanical design at the component level.
  • Access to proprietary knowledge of optical performance specifications.
  • Access to detailed mechanical drawings, including CAD drawings.
  • Ability to supply custom modifications of standard components when required by the OEM's design criteria.
  • Ability to develop custom objectives, when required by the OEM's optical requirements. With so many Carl Zeiss microscope objectives from which to choose, custom modifications are rarely required.

    Carl Zeiss aims to be the preferred component and/or microscope system partner by providing outstanding support and unsurpassed optical and mechanical performance. This will allow OEM partner companies to bring their products to market quickly and successfully, regardless of their specific system solution.

    About Carl Zeiss

    Carl Zeiss MicroImaging, Inc., a subsidiary of Carl Zeiss, Inc., offers microscopy solutions and systems for research, laboratories, routine and industrial applications. In addition, Carl Zeiss MicroImaging markets microscopy and digital pathology systems for the clinical market, as well as spectral sensors for industrial and pharmaceutical applications. Since1846, Carl Zeiss has remained committed to enabling science and technology to go beyond what man can see. Today, Carl Zeiss is a global leader in the optical and opto-electronic industries.

    With 11,249 current employees in the Group and offices in over 30 countries, Carl Zeiss is represented in more than 100 countries with production centers in Europe, North America, Central America and Asia.
